
Powdery mildew and Mr. Granny finally did it in. We could no longer walk around the side of the house, and Mr. G hit it with the riding lawnmower the other day, so I decided its time had come. That one plant dwarfs the
garden cart!

Two overgrown zukes were found in the process, as well as one of edible size that will be sliced and fried tonight. There were several tiny squash left on the vine, and many more blossoms, so it would have continued to bear until it froze. Oh well, all good things must come to an end, and I certainly can't complain about the 70 pounds of zucchini it gave us, which is a record crop for me by nearly fifty pounds! By the way, those two large zucchinis will not be added to the edible totals for the year, they will be composted. The large one weighed 6 pounds 7 ounces, and the other biggie was 5 pounds 6 ounces.
